VS FFA member Stephen Stinson earns American Degree
Every once in a while in an FFA chapter’s history, there is a member who decides he or she wants to earn the highest degree awarded to an FFA member, the American Degree.
On November 2, 2013 in Louisville, Kentucky at the National FFA Convention, Stephen Stinson will be receiving his American Degree. Stephen is the twenty-first person from the Vinton-Shellsburg FFA chapter to receive this degree, since our chapter was started back in 1930.

Suspect arrested for thefts from unlocked Vinton cars, buildings
Since last Thursday night, Oct. 10, the suspect believed responsible for latest string of thefts from unlocked cars and buildings has been in jail, and the reports of property thefts have ceased.
The arrest came shortly after the Chicago Bears defeated the New York Giants on Thursday Night Football, says Bears fan Josh Boddicker. Boddicker was inside his grandmother’s house on 12th Street near Tilford Elementary, when from inside his grandmother’s house, he saw through a window facing the garage that the security light had been activated.
Girl Scouts to go 'trick or treating' for Food Pantry, Oct. 22
Girl Scout Troop 6652 will be out trick or treating in Vinton for the Food Pantry on Tuesday, October 22, 2013, from 6:15 p.m. until 7:15 p.m. The Food Pantry needs include toothbrushes, toothpaste, shampoo, etc., in addition to canned goods. The Girl Scout motto is to teach them to be girls of Courage, Confidence and Character. We appreciate your support as we encourage our Girl Scouts to make a difference in our community.
